Discover the 200m Magnolia Tunnel in Gimhae

While many travelers flock to well-known cherry blossom spots, Gimhae hides a unique floral treasure known as the Magnolia Forest. Located in Heungdong, this forest may not be sprawling in size, but it makes a grand impression with its dense 200-meter path lined with majestic magnolia trees.

Walking through the forest feels like stepping into a dream as the white petals flutter in the warm spring breeze. The trees grow tall on both sides of the path, creating a natural canopy that provides a sense of seclusion and beauty that is quickly becoming a favorite among local flower enthusiasts and photographers.

Spotting the Rare Pinkish-Purple Magnolias

Among the sea of white popcorn-like blossoms, you can find a hidden surprise: pinkish-purple magnolias. These vibrant flowers add a pop of color to the forest and are highly sought after for their unique beauty. Keep in mind that these colorful varieties typically bloom about one week later than the white ones.

Combining the purity of the white magnolias with the richness of the purple blossoms creates a diverse landscape for your visit. It's a wonderful place to experience "Youngchunghwa," a name given to magnolias because they are the flowers that officially welcome the spring season.

Photography Tips for the Perfect Spring Snapshot

Gimhae Magnolia Forest has gained a reputation as a "Photo 맛집" or a top-tier photography spot. To make the most of your visit, we recommend coming on a sunny day when the contrast between the white petals and the deep blue sky is most striking.

For the best results, wearing bright or light-colored clothing will help you stand out against the floral background. The natural lighting filtered through the branches creates a soft, flattering glow that is perfect for portraits with family, friends, or lovers.

Planning Your Visit: Peak Bloom Dates

Magnolias are notoriously fleeting, with petals that fall quickly once they reach full bloom. For the current season, the peak viewing period is estimated to be between mid-March. If you visit between the upcoming weekend and the middle of next week, you are likely to catch the trees in their most magnificent state.

Please note that there is no separate parking lot at this location, so it is wise to plan your transportation accordingly. Taking a moment to appreciate these flowers, which symbolize nobility and purity, is a guaranteed way to heal your mind and embrace the new season.
